did a 450 mile ... 120 MPH round around southern MN this morning/afternoon.

From New Ulm to Rochester..... west to Souix Falls SD ... back to New Ulm.

% wise..... about half nice green corn.... half "lime green" corn. Not much drown outs going SE.

A little better going west along the IA border... but not much.

Half way back to New Ulm....drown out spots started showing up..... getting worse the further NE one goes.

Even tho had super weather this summer, the dumping the end of June took it's toll.

Have no idea if to say "normal" will hold the yield or not. Some of the corn is in spots....right across the road....whole 80's look hurt.

Would guess 10 - 15% beans drowned out in many places on the last half of last leg.
